Turkish Airlines operates flights across Europe and worldwide. Many of its flights fall under EU261 passenger rights regulation when:
The flight departs from an EU airport
OR arrives in the EU on an EU-based ticket itinerary
The airline is responsible for the disruption
You may file a turkish airlines compensation claim if your flight:
Arrived 3+ hours late
Was cancelled less than 14 days before departure
You were denied boarding due to overbooking
You missed a connecting flight because of airline delay
Compensation is not paid when the airline has no control over the disruption.
Extraordinary circumstances include:
Severe weather conditions
Airport strikes not related to airline staff
Political instability
Air traffic control restrictions
Security emergencies
However, even in these cases you still receive care (food, hotel, rebooking).
Besides financial compensation, travelers are entitled to immediate assistance during delays.
After waiting certain hours at the airport, Turkish Airlines must provide:
Free meals and refreshments
Hotel accommodation (overnight delays)
Airport transfers
Phone calls or internet access
For cancellations, you can choose:
Full refund
Alternative flight (earliest available)
Travel on a later date of your preference

Sometimes airlines reject valid requests due to incomplete details.
You can escalate to:
National Aviation Authority in EU country of departure
Alternative dispute resolution body
Small claims court (last option)
Most passengers win after escalation when eligibility is proven.
File claim within 3 years (varies by country)
Attach screenshots and receipts
Mention exact arrival delay time (not departure delay)
Do not accept travel vouchers unless you want them
